Output e3d514bc51cf20eae203040af4a8a2711a995d294ffca8644f0584ebaa19e9f6:0

value
341673894
script pubkey
OP_0 OP_PUSHBYTES_20 77bbfd0c0a321053897df5514c3da36844beb3cc
address
bc1qw7al6rq2xgg98zta74g5c0drdpztav7vxt97nj
transaction
e3d514bc51cf20eae203040af4a8a2711a995d294ffca8644f0584ebaa19e9f6
spent
true